Biography

“Neiman creates intricate and tightly knit melodies…an instrumental virtuoso in his own right.” - Jakob Baekgaard All About Jazz

Guitarist Oren Neiman’s music is both innovative and in the forefront of today’s jazz styles, as well as being celebrated for his technical precision. His compositions explore a combination of Jazz sensibility with Middle Eastern rhythms and melody.

Born in Ramat-Gan, Israel, and raised in Toronto Canada, and Israel, he grew up listening to many different kinds of music; He started playing mainly in rock bands, but soon became interested in jazz. Oren considers both of his cultural backgrounds to be integral to his music and has a strong connection with both countries.

In August 2001, Oren moved to NY, where his quartet is currently based.

Oren’s current projects include: Recording and performing with The Oren Neiman Quartet: with their second album “Frolic and Detour” released in April 2009, the band is currently performing in support of the album.
The energetic acoustic duo “IsraAlien” led by fellow Israeli guitar player Gilad Ben Zvi, this duo delves into the world of Mediterranean gypsy music and is currently touring in support of their first self-titled release “IsraAlien” ( May 2009 )
Producing and performing in “Nigunim – A Festival of New Improvised Jewish Music”, Oren put together this festival in 2009 to create a stage in Westchester NY for his music as well as other performers of this genre.

Oren has regularly performed with his quartet in NY venues like The 55 Bar, Cornelia St. Cafe and Makor to name a few, as well as touring nationally and internationally (most recently Spain, Canada and Israel). Oren was also an Artist in Residence at the 92nd St. Y (2006-2007), a participant in the Banff Centre’s international Jazz workshop (2008) and has received an Arts Alive project grant from Westchester Arts Council (2009, 2011).
